Variety description

10 August 2026

The variety was selected from grass populations naturally growing in contaminated territories. Its main feature is its resistance to high lead and zinc content in the soil, as well as the ability to survive in conditions of low fertility, cold, and drought.

The plant possesses specific physiological adaptations, while being characterized by slow growth and low suitability for ornamental turfgrass use. In a number of studies, its resistance to the disease "dollar spot" was noted.
